Repeated Injections of Adipose-derived Stem Cells in Rotator Cuff Tears
Starting soon · Phase 1/Phase 2 · Has a placebo group
Conditions studied: Rotator Cuff Tears, Rotator Cuff Injuries, Stem Cells
In brief
The aim of the project is to investigate whether repeated implantations of micro-fragmented adipose tissue (MFAT), into the shoulder muscle can improve the outcome of standard surgical treatment for rotator cuff tears (RCT). The investigators hypothesize that combining surgery with repeated implantations of micro-fragmented adipose tissue (MFAT) into the muscle provides a more effective treatment for patients with rotator cuff tears compared to standard surgical treatment. The result would be better outcomes such as improved shoulder functioning and reduced pain.

Who can join
Age: 30 and older, up to 69. Sex: any. Healthy volunteers: not accepted.
You may qualify if…
- Clinical signs and symptoms compatible with a traumatic RCT
- MR verified supraspinatus tear
- Reparable lesion with tendon retraction < 2 cm.
- Fatty infiltration level 0-2 according to Fuchs or out of 5 based on Goutalliers classification
- No history of inflammatory disease
- Negative infectious disease marker tests Signed consent to the study
You may not qualify if…
- Former surgery in the affected shoulder
- Signs of infection
- Immunosuppression (due to clinical condition or medical therapy)
- Any malignancy within 5 years prior to screening
- Previous radiotherapy to the shoulder
- BMI under 18
- BMI above 35
- Allergy to antibiotics such as penicillin
- Coagulopathy
